Variegated Monstera Juno care guide

🌞 Light Requirements:

  • Best Light: Prefers bright, indirect light to maintain its variegation.
  • Tip: Avoid harsh direct sunlight, which can scorch the white portions of the leaves.

💧 Watering:

  • Frequency: Water when the top 2-3 cm of soil feels dry.
  • Tip: Ensure the pot drains well to prevent root rot.

🌿 Soil & Repotting:

  • Recommended Mix: For optimal drainage and healthy roots, you can use our premixed Aroid Mix, or you can create your own potting mix using Barks Unlimited Potting Soil combined with Perlite.
  • Repotting: Repot every 1-2 years when root-bound. During repotting, consider incorporating Bark Chips into the mix for improved aeration and root health.

🌡️ Temperature:

  • Preferred Range: Thrives between 18-27°C.
  • Tip: Protect from cold drafts and avoid temperatures below 15°C.

💦 Humidity:

  • Adaptability: Prefers moderate to high humidity.
  • Boost: Mist occasionally or place near a humidifier for enhanced foliage health.

🌻 Fertilizing:

✂️ Pruning and Maintenance:

  • Pruning: Remove damaged or yellowing leaves to maintain its stunning appearance.
  • Cleaning: Wipe leaves gently with a damp cloth to keep them dust-free.

🌱 Propagation:

  • Method: Best propagated using stem cuttings with at least one node.
  • Timing: Ideal during spring or summer.

🐛 Common Pests and Problems:

  • Pests: Monitor for spider mites, mealybugs, and aphids. Treat with an insecticidal spray if needed.
  • Browning Leaves: Often due to low humidity or underwatering.

🌍 Special Notes:

  • Air Purifying: Known for its air-purifying properties.
  • Pet Safety: Toxic if ingested. Keep away from pets and children.
